Best Internet Providers in Low Moor, VA

In Low Moor, Virginia, Viasat Internet covers 100% of the community with satellite internet. It offers a maximum download speed of 150 Mbps. The service starts at $199.99 per month, which might be steep for some users but could benefit those with high internet demands for streaming or multiple devices.

Hughesnet and Lumos also cover the entire community. Hughesnet, a satellite internet provider too, offers up to 100 Mbps download speed for a more affordable starting price of $49.99 per month. Lumos provides fiber internet with speeds up to 1 Gbps, starting at $50 per month. With 91% of Low Moor having fiber coverage, Lumos offers high speed at a competitive price.

The internet landscape in Low Moor features 100% satellite coverage and 91% fiber, while DSL is available to 6% and cable to 42% of residents. This ensures that residents have reliable and varied options.
